The Importance Of Emergency Fire Telephones: Ensuring Safety And Rapid Response

emergency fire telephones, also known as fire alarm telephones or fire call boxes, are crucial tools in ensuring the safety of individuals in case of a fire emergency. These devices provide a direct and immediate means of communication with emergency responders, allowing for a rapid response that can help prevent the spread of fire and save lives. In this article, we will explore the importance of emergency fire telephones and how they play a key role in emergency preparedness and response.

One of the main benefits of emergency fire telephones is their direct connection to emergency responders, such as the fire department or building security personnel. In the event of a fire, individuals can simply pick up the handset of the fire telephone and immediately be connected to emergency services. This quick and efficient communication is essential in getting help to the scene of the fire as soon as possible, minimizing the risk of injury or property damage.

Unlike traditional telephones or cell phones, emergency fire telephones are specifically designed for use during fire emergencies. These devices are typically located in easily accessible areas throughout buildings, such as stairwells, hallways, or near building exits. This strategic placement ensures that individuals can quickly locate and use the fire telephone in case of an emergency, without wasting precious time searching for a phone or trying to remember emergency contact numbers.

Another important feature of emergency fire telephones is their reliability during emergencies. Unlike cell phones, which may experience network congestion or signal issues during a crisis, fire telephones provide a direct line of communication that is not dependent on external factors. This ensures that individuals can reliably reach emergency services when every second counts.

In addition to their role in alerting emergency responders, emergency fire telephones also play a crucial role in building evacuation procedures. When a fire alarm is activated, individuals are often instructed to evacuate the building via designated emergency exits. Fire telephones provide an additional layer of safety by allowing individuals to report the location and severity of the fire to emergency responders, helping to guide evacuation efforts and ensuring that everyone is accounted for.

One of the key aspects of emergency fire telephones is their simplicity and ease of use. These devices are typically equipped with clear instructions on how to use them, making it easy for individuals of all ages and backgrounds to quickly and effectively communicate with emergency services. In high-stress situations such as fires, having a user-friendly communication tool can make all the difference in ensuring a timely and effective response.

emergency fire telephones are also designed to withstand the harsh conditions often present during a fire emergency. These devices are built to be durable and resistant to extreme temperatures and smoke, ensuring that they remain functional when needed most. Additionally, many fire telephones are equipped with a backup power source, such as batteries or generators, to ensure continued operation in the event of a power outage.
